Transaction 93f073dbfc3c22d56b6cb9124c33486023c2fd5983e42f37b7d0dec17c6c1222

2 Input
2 Outputs
  • 93f073dbfc3c22d56b6cb9124c33486023c2fd5983e42f37b7d0dec17c6c1222:0
  • value  127822
    address  3J5Dv5iFS7xUUV8YBmZHCE6jXKA1cwsHWm
  • 93f073dbfc3c22d56b6cb9124c33486023c2fd5983e42f37b7d0dec17c6c1222:1
  • value  19438490702
    address  3Eab4nDg6WJ5WR1uvWQirtMzWaA34RQk9s